Abstract

The purpose of the research is to study the novel structure metal-insulator-metal (MIM) rectified antenna (rectenna) and its efficiency for optical frequencies mixing and rectification. Semiconductor diodes have many imperfections such as heat problem and slow response, while MIM devices have less heat problem issues and have response times in the order of femtoseconds.
